Q: Is 609,468 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 609,468 is not a prime number.

Why is 609,468 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 609468 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 12 50,789 101,578 152,367 203,156 304,734 and 609,468, with no remainder.

Since 609,468 cannot be divided by just 1 and 609,468, it is not a prime number.
